ANNUAL RUGBY CLASSIC

Long regarded as one of the best sporting and social events in the international rugby calendar, the 30th Annual World Rugby Classic took place in Bermuda November. Showcasing many of the best rugby stars who have recently embraced retirement as well as some of the world’s leading businesses, the Bermuda Classic has grown from an Easter retreat for retired players in the 1970s into an international tournament of some repute.

Togging out in some distinctive Classic Lions garb in 2017 were David Corkery, Tomás O’Leary, Marcus Horan, Mike Ross and AIL stalwart David Moore. All were to the fore as the Classic Lions overcame the Classic Springboks in the Plate Final. In the main event however, the Classic Pumas won the title for the first time since 2011 when they saw off a Classic All Blacks side.
